WHAT’S THE OPPORTUNITY?

We are looking for a Senior HCM Program Manager with a strong background in HR systems, specifically Workday, to join our People team and drive operational excellence across our teams. This role is a unique opportunity to shape the way we leverage Workday to streamline processes for Recruiting Ops, People Ops, Compensation, and other key teams, ensuring efficient, scalable, and user-friendly systems and processes. Operational excellence in this context means creating systems and workflows that reduce manual effort, minimise errors, and empower teams to focus on strategic work by leveraging Workday’s capabilities to their fullest potential. The scope of this role will encompass the full breadth of the hire-to-retire business process, ensuring alignment across all stages of the employee lifecycle. By aligning and prioritising needs across the People organisation (as internal stakeholders) and Finance (as an external stakeholder with dependencies on People), you’ll ensure that Workday becomes a cornerstone for data-driven decision-making, compliance, and improved employee experiences. You’ll also play a critical role in defining and maintaining a cohesive Workday roadmap in collaboration with our People Systems team.
